Higher-Level Review: Upon your request, a senior reviewer will go over your entire claim again to determine if the VA can make a new decision based on an error with the initial claim, or an error that was the result of a difference of opinion between reviewers. The eBenefits system is a pirate operation in that it takes from other systems such as VBMS (Veterans Benefits Management System) and generates little on its own. You are not alone! These programs read and write to a database, which eBenefits pulls data from to report status. The Veterans Health Administration (VHA) takes care of your healthcare, while the Veterans Benefits Administration (VBA) is in charge of all benefits you receive for your disabilities.
